Output f58b9336449b61b790268425914e354da57b5e9148d37db68bd9ad994973dd8f:1

value
1753343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4265529a457599066b3fc4971e218e9cd376039 OP_EQUALVERIFY OP_CHECKSIG
address
1MoLz8zFP3Gpm9A91qhtBiqoxh2dztT68r
transaction
f58b9336449b61b790268425914e354da57b5e9148d37db68bd9ad994973dd8f
spent
true